Types of Silicone for Molding

There are various types of silicone available for mold-making, each suited for different applications. Two-part liquid silicone is common for complex molds; it’s mixed and poured around an object to capture detail. Brush-on silicone works well for larger items or surfaces with intricate textures. It’s applied in layers to build up a mold over time. Silicone putty is simple to use; it’s mixed by hand and pressed around an object, great for making small, detailed molds. Each type has its own benefits, helping creators select the best option for their project’s needs.

Advantages of Silicone Molds

Silicone molds offer several benefits, making them a favorite among DIY enthusiasts. Their flexibility allows for easy removal of cast items without damage. This reduces the risk of breaking or cracking, which is especially important when working with fragile materials. Heat resistance is another key feature; silicone can withstand high temperatures, which is ideal for projects involving hot substances, such as candle making. Additionally, durability of silicone molds guarantees multiple uses, making them cost-effective over time. Creating Your Own Silicone Mold

Creating a silicone mold can add a personal touch to your DIY projects. Understanding the materials, designing the prototype, and knowing the process of mixing, pouring, and curing silicone are key steps in making your own mold.

Materials Required

To create a silicone mold, gather a few specific materials. Start with a silicone mold-making kit, often including two parts labeled “Part A” and “Part B.” These are the base and the catalyst. You’ll also need a mixing container and stir sticks. It’s helpful to have protective gear like gloves.

A release agent prevents the silicone from sticking to the prototype. Finally, prepare a flat surface where the mold can cure. Bits of clay or tape can help secure your prototype.

Designing the Prototype

Designing a prototype starts with selecting the item to duplicate. Consider the features, size, and complexity of what you want to mold. Use polymer clay or air-dry clay to shape a simple model. Sealing wood or porous objects helps when making a mold.

Think about the mold’s usage before starting. Whether the item will be used for resin casting or another application can influence your design choices.

Mixing and Pouring Silicone

Once the materials are ready, mix the silicone. Start with equal parts of “Part A” and “Part B.” Use the stir stick to combine until the mix is uniform. Avoid bubbles by stirring slowly.

Pour the mixture over the prototype in a steady stream. Begin at the lowest point to limit air bubbles. If using brush-on silicone, apply thin layers with a brush. Let each layer settle before adding more.

Curing and Demolding

Curing time depends on the silicone used. Most need several hours at room temperature. Check the specific guidelines that came with your silicone kit. After curing, test the mold’s flexibility and firmness before proceeding.

Carefully peel back the mold from one edge, easing it away from the object. The release agent aids in this process, helping separate the prototype without damage.

Finishing Touches and Usage

Examine your new silicone mold for any rough edges. Trim these with scissors if necessary. Wash the mold gently to remove any residue before using it.

Now, your mold is ready for project work. It’s suitable for creating resin castings, jewelry, or other items you’re crafting. With care, the mold can be used repeatedly, adding versatility to your DIY toolset.
